St. Louis signed Nestor Molina (Lara) to a minor league deal.  He made 13 starts for Lara during the regular season posting a 7-5 record, 3.98 ERA, and 1.31 WHIP.  He allowed 66 hits, 29 runs (28 earned), six home runs, 17 walks, hit two batters, and struck 44 out over 63.1 innings.  Molina has one start, during the playoffs, allowing three hits, two runs (one earned), one home run, one walk, and struck four out over 5.2 innings.
